PRECIOUS AND UNIQUE

Samuel Thadeus Short

“Every grain of dust has a wonderful soul.”

— Joan Miro

Human beings have been known to act toward other people as though they were things, objects instead of subjects like themselves. Men sometimes act this way toward women; parents toward children, the young toward the old. We must guard against this tendency among ourselves which is literally disrespect for the individual and is always dangerous.

Each human is a unique and precious being. It injures the spirit to forget that even for a moment. And when we remember it, we are able to act in concert with our self respecting humans. In respecting ourselves fully, we show others how to treat us, and as we treat them respectfully we acknowledge and enhance humanity.

The quality of human interactions can be so wonderful; why should we deface it by forgetting the uniqueness of others?
